Whitpain Public School, also known as Whitpain High School and the 1895 School, is a historic school building located at Blue Bell, Montgomery County, Pennsylvania. It was built in 1895, and is a two-story, stucco covered stone and brick building. It is in a Late Victorian style with Queen Anne and Gothic Revival style details. It measure 37 feet wide by 50 feet deep, and sits on a fieldstone foundation. It features an entrance porch and numerous Gothic arches.[2]

It was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 2006.[1]
